C# Класс Vtex.Gallery.Context.Connectors.WorkspacesContextConnector

Наследование: ContextConnector
Показать файл Открыть проект Примеры использования класса

Защищенные свойства (Protected)

Свойство Тип Описание
CachedApps IReadOnlyList
CachedArchive FileList
CachedFileList IReadOnlyList
CachedFiles File>.Dictionary
CachedMetadata Metadata
CachedSettings Settings

Открытые методы

Метод Описание
GetAppsAsync ( CancellationToken cancellationToken ) : Task>
GetFileAsync ( string path, CancellationToken cancellationToken ) : Task
GetMetadataAsync ( CancellationToken cancellationToken ) : Task
GetSettingsAsync ( CancellationToken cancellationToken ) : Task
ListFilesAsync ( CancellationToken cancellationToken ) : Task>
SaveAsync ( string message, FileChange changes, CancellationToken cancellationToken ) : Task
WorkspacesContextConnector ( IExtendedWorkspacesClient client, string account, string workspace, SandboxCollection sandboxes, string serviceName, string excludePrefixes ) : System.Collections.Generic

Приватные методы

Метод Описание
GetArchiveAsync ( CancellationToken cancellationToken ) : Task

Описание методов

GetAppsAsync() публичный Метод

public GetAppsAsync ( CancellationToken cancellationToken ) : Task>
cancellationToken System.Threading.CancellationToken
Результат Task>

GetFileAsync() публичный Метод

public GetFileAsync ( string path, CancellationToken cancellationToken ) : Task
path string
cancellationToken System.Threading.CancellationToken
Результат Task

GetMetadataAsync() публичный Метод

public GetMetadataAsync ( CancellationToken cancellationToken ) : Task
cancellationToken System.Threading.CancellationToken
Результат Task

GetSettingsAsync() публичный Метод

public GetSettingsAsync ( CancellationToken cancellationToken ) : Task
cancellationToken System.Threading.CancellationToken
Результат Task

ListFilesAsync() публичный Метод

public ListFilesAsync ( CancellationToken cancellationToken ) : Task>
cancellationToken System.Threading.CancellationToken
Результат Task>

SaveAsync() публичный Метод

public SaveAsync ( string message, FileChange changes, CancellationToken cancellationToken ) : Task
message string
changes Vtex.Workspaces.Client.Models.Request.FileChange
cancellationToken System.Threading.CancellationToken
Результат Task

WorkspacesContextConnector() публичный Метод

public WorkspacesContextConnector ( IExtendedWorkspacesClient client, string account, string workspace, SandboxCollection sandboxes, string serviceName, string excludePrefixes ) : System.Collections.Generic
client IExtendedWorkspacesClient
account string
workspace string
sandboxes SandboxCollection
serviceName string
excludePrefixes string
Результат System.Collections.Generic

Описание свойств

CachedApps защищенное свойство

protected IReadOnlyList CachedApps
Результат IReadOnlyList

CachedArchive защищенное свойство

protected FileList CachedArchive
Результат FileList

CachedFileList защищенное свойство

protected IReadOnlyList CachedFileList
Результат IReadOnlyList

CachedFiles защищенное свойство

protected Dictionary CachedFiles
Результат File>.Dictionary

CachedMetadata защищенное свойство

protected Metadata CachedMetadata
Результат Metadata

CachedSettings защищенное свойство

protected Settings CachedSettings
Результат Settings